Timothee Chalamet might as well be an honorary Knick at this point. The “Marty Supreme” star partied with the players at the Seville in New York on Monday night and it felt like “he’s a part of the team,” a spy told Page Six.
“He was so friendly with the players, so happy… dancing and hanging out with everybody. It was like he’s a teammate. They were so engaged,” they added.
Chalamet arrived to the party solo and we’re told he was in “very high spirits,” hanging out with Jalen Brunson, Karl Anthony-Towns, OG Anunoby, Mohamed Diawara, Josh Hart and other players. “He was elated,” the source said of Chalamet.
The evening also brought out Kit Harrington, Jim Jones, Fabolous, A Boogie wit da Hoodie, Ciara and Russel Wilson. Guests noshed on food served by Scarpetta, and were treated to performances by A$AP Ferg and Fetty Wap.
We hear the young players teased LDV Hospitality’s John Meadow, who hosted the party, by referring to him as “sir.” A highlight of the evening was when the champions received custom Don Julio 1942 bottles inscribed to commemorate their historic win, we’re told.
It’s been nonstop celebrating for the players since they defeated the San Antonio Spurs and made history by winning their first championship since 1973. On Sunday, David Rodolitz opened his private members spot, Flyfish Club, to host a victory party for the NBA stars, where they raged until 3 a.m.
“All the players were in tremendous spirits [and] high energy,” Rodolitz exclusively told Page Six. “There was a lot of chemistry with these guys — like, the natural chemistry and the way they move on the court, it continued at Flyfish Club. It was collaborative. There was so much love and fun and joy.”
Trey Jemison III and Kevin McCullar Jr., were spotted celebrating with their wives and girlfriends at Sushi by Boū’s Times Square location. Perhaps Chalamet recommended it. (He and Kylie Jenner had a double date at its Lower East Side location last month).
The players’ party at Seville wrapped at around 3:30 a.m., giving them plenty of time to rest up before Thursday’s big parade.
